Output 34c300bc19844a5b829b63896b0c81fd26a973574dcaef1ed213123900187183:0

value
73145009
script pubkey
OP_0 OP_PUSHBYTES_20 afdb6ee6fa799fdee085cfe687c9cb8e84153c59
address
ltc1q4ldkaeh60x0aacy9elng0jwt36zp20ze35pv44
transaction
34c300bc19844a5b829b63896b0c81fd26a973574dcaef1ed213123900187183
spent
true